Routine Cleaning and Inspection

Proper cleaning and regular inspections are the cornerstones of a maintenance plan for the Shimano FC-5700 crankset. Dirt, grime, and chain lubrication buildup can interfere with the smooth operation of the crankset. Here’s how to keep it clean:

  1. Cleaning: After each ride, take a few minutes to wipe down the crankset with a clean cloth. Use a mild soap solution and water to remove dirt and grease that may have accumulated. Avoid using harsh chemicals or solvents, as they can damage the protective finish of the crankset.
  2. Detailed Inspection: During cleaning, inspect the crankset for any signs of wear or damage. Look for cracks, bent crank arms, or signs of corrosion. Check the chainring teeth for any rounding or deformation. If you notice any damage or irregularities, address them immediately to avoid further issues.

Lubrication of Key Components

Lubricating moving parts is vital for smooth performance and the prevention of corrosion. The Shimano FC-5700 crankset has several key components that require lubrication.

  1. Pedal Threads: Apply a thin layer of grease to the pedal threads before installing them. This helps prevent rust and makes it easier to remove the pedals later.
  2. Bottom Bracket Interface: The interface between the crankset and the bottom bracket should be lubricated to ensure smooth rotation and to prevent creaking sounds. Use high-quality grease on the axle interface before installing the crankset.
  3. Crank Arm Bolts: Apply a small amount of grease to the crank arm bolts before tightening them. This not only ensures easy removal but also prevents the bolts from seizing over time.

Tightening and Adjustment

Proper torque and adjustments are critical for the longevity of the Shimano FC-5700 crankset. If your crankset is loose or misaligned, it could affect shifting performance and overall riding efficiency.

  1. Crank Arm Bolt Tightening: Over time, crank arm bolts may loosen due to repeated pedaling and vibration. Ensure that your crank arm bolts are tightened to the manufacturer’s recommended torque specifications, typically around 12-14 Nm for the FC-5700.
  2. Chainring Bolts: Periodically check the chainring bolts to ensure they are secure. These bolts should also be tightened to the correct torque setting—usually around 8-10 Nm.
  3. Bottom Bracket Tightening: The bottom bracket interface needs to be checked as well. If you notice any play or unusual noises coming from the bottom bracket, tighten it to the proper torque value. The FC-5700 crankset is compatible with Shimano’s Hollowtech II bottom bracket system, and this should be properly adjusted to prevent any issues.

Bearings and Bottom Bracket Maintenance

Maintaining the bearings and bottom bracket is critical for ensuring smooth power transfer. The FC-5700 uses Shimano’s Hollowtech II technology, which incorporates external bearings housed in the crankset’s bottom bracket.

  1. Bearing Inspection: Spin the crankset by hand and listen for any roughness or resistance from the bearings. If the bearings feel gritty or rough, they may need to be replaced. External bearings typically last between 2,000 to 3,000 miles depending on riding conditions.
  2. Bottom Bracket Maintenance: Inspect the bottom bracket for signs of damage or wear. If you detect any play in the bottom bracket or excessive resistance, it might be time to service or replace it. Ensure that the bottom bracket is correctly installed with proper lubrication to avoid damaging the crankset.

Chainring and Crank Arm Alignment

A common cause of shifting issues and drivetrain misalignment on the FC-5700 is incorrect chainring or crank arm alignment.

  1. Chainring Check: Over time, chainrings can become misaligned or suffer from bent teeth. If the teeth are excessively worn or misshapen, replace the chainring. Proper alignment of the chainring ensures smooth shifting and prevents the chain from slipping.
  2. Crank Arm Alignment: Misaligned crank arms can cause pedaling inefficiency and discomfort. When reinstalling the crank arms, make sure that they are properly aligned and securely fastened. Pay attention to the manufacturer’s recommended crank arm torque to prevent loosening during use.

Chain and Drivetrain Maintenance

The performance of your Shimano FC-5700 crankset is closely tied to the health of your chain and other drivetrain components. Keeping these parts clean and properly adjusted will help to maintain smooth operation.

  1. Chain Cleaning and Lubrication: Clean your chain regularly to remove dirt, oil, and grit. A dirty chain can cause unnecessary wear on the chainring teeth and the crankset. Lubricate the chain after cleaning with a suitable chain lube to ensure smooth shifting.
  2. Chain Wear Check: Over time, chains stretch, and worn chains can damage the chainring teeth and derailleur components. Use a chain checker tool to monitor chain wear. Replace the chain if it shows excessive wear, as this will prolong the life of the crankset and other drivetrain components.

Crankset Replacement Indicators

While the Shimano FC-5700 crankset is built to last, there may come a time when it needs to be replaced. Keep an eye out for the following indicators:

  1. Excessive Chainring Wear: If the teeth on the chainring are severely worn or damaged, it may cause shifting issues or even chain slipping. If the damage is beyond simple repair or reshaping, consider replacing the chainring or crankset.
  2. Worn Bearings: If the crankset starts to feel rough or there is noticeable resistance when spinning the pedals, it could indicate bearing failure. Replace the bearings if they are no longer smooth.
  3. Crank Arm Damage: If the crank arms are cracked, bent, or show signs of significant wear, it is time for a replacement.
